Vietjet Launches Daily Flights Between Hanoi
and Bali, Indonesia
|
Vietjet has launched the first direct route between
Hanoi, Vietnams capital city, and the popular tourist destination
of to Bali, Indonesia.
This is the airline's second service to the
world-famous holiday island, as Vietjet has been operating flights between Saigon and
Bali since May 2019.
The daily flight is scheduled to depart from Hanoi at 10:00
and arrive in Bali at 16:25.
The return leg is timed to leave Bali at 17:30
and land in Hanoi at 21:55.
Chairwoman of Vietjets Board of Directors, Nguyen Thanh Ha, said, Vietjet was
founded with a pioneering mission to connect the skies. We are
proud to be the first airline to operate direct flights between
Hanoi and Bali. The new route, operated from the second day of the
Lunar New Year, will meet the New Years travel demand of the
locals and international travellers with less travel time and
cost. Not only connecting the two most attractive cultural tourism
destinations in Asia, the Hanoi - Bali route will also further
promote cooperation between the countries in ASEAN.
